What are the main types of money transfer services available?

Money transfer services come in several forms, each catering to different needs and preferences. Traditional bank transfers remain a popular choice for many, offering the security of established financial institutions. Online money transfer services, such as PayPal and TransferWise, have gained traction due to their convenience and often competitive rates. Mobile payment apps like Venmo and Cash App have revolutionized peer-to-peer transfers, making it easy to split bills or send money to friends instantly. For international transfers, specialized services like Western Union and MoneyGram provide extensive global networks, allowing cash pickups in various locations worldwide.

How can you evaluate the security of a money transfer provider?

When it comes to transferring money, security is paramount. Start by researching the provider’s reputation and reading user reviews. Look for services that use encryption technology to protect your personal and financial information. Verify that the company is licensed and regulated by relevant financial authorities in your country. Many reputable providers offer fraud protection and secure authentication methods, such as two-factor authentication. It’s also wise to check if the service is insured or provides any guarantees against loss of funds due to technical issues or fraud.

What factors affect transfer speed and fees?

Several factors influence the speed and cost of money transfers. The method of transfer plays a significant role; bank transfers typically take longer but may have lower fees for large amounts. Online services often provide faster transfers but may charge higher fees for instant transactions. The destination of the transfer also impacts both speed and cost, with domestic transfers generally being quicker and cheaper than international ones. The amount being sent can affect fees, with some providers offering better rates for larger transfers. Additionally, the payment method (credit card, bank account, or cash) can influence both the speed of the transaction and the associated fees.

How do local and international transfers differ?

Local transfers, typically within the same country, are often faster and less expensive than international transfers. They usually involve simpler processes and fewer regulatory hurdles. International transfers, on the other hand, involve currency exchange, which can affect the final amount received due to exchange rates and additional fees. These transfers may also take longer due to international banking systems and compliance checks. Some services specialize in specific corridors or regions, offering competitive rates for certain international routes. It’s important to compare different providers for international transfers, as fees and exchange rates can vary significantly.

How do you choose the best money transfer service for your needs?

Selecting the right money transfer service depends on your specific requirements. Consider factors such as transfer frequency, amount, destination, and urgency. For frequent small transfers to friends, mobile apps might be ideal. For large international transfers, services specializing in forex might offer better rates. Compare the total cost of the transfer, including fees and exchange rates, rather than just looking at the transfer fee alone. Consider the convenience of the service, including user interface and integration with your bank accounts. Lastly, ensure the service is available and reliable in both the sending and receiving countries.


When comparing money transfer services, it’s helpful to look at real-world examples. Here’s a comparison of some popular providers:

Provider Transfer Speed International Availability Typical Fees
PayPal Instant to 1-3 business days 200+ countries 2.9% + $0.30 for domestic, 5% for international
TransferWise 0-2 business days 80+ countries 0.4% - 1.5% of transfer amount
Western Union Minutes to 5 business days 200+ countries $5 - $45 depending on method and destination
Xoom Minutes to 3 business days 160+ countries $4.99 - $30.99 depending on method and destination
